开源项目 debug-menu
使用教程
项目介绍
debug-menu
是一个用于在应用程序中创建调试菜单的开源工具。它允许开发者在应用程序中集成一个调试界面,以便于在开发和测试过程中快速访问和修改内部状态。这个工具特别适用于需要频繁调试的应用程序,如游戏开发、复杂的前端应用等。
项目快速启动
安装
首先,你需要通过 npm 安装 debug-menu
:
npm install debug-menu
基本使用
以下是一个简单的示例,展示如何在你的项目中集成 debug-menu
:
const debugMenu = require('debug-menu');
// 初始化调试菜单
const menu = debugMenu.create({
title: '调试菜单',
items: [
{
label: '显示日志',
action: () => {
console.log('显示日志');
}
},
{
label: '重置数据',
action: () => {
console.log('重置数据');
}
}
]
});
// 显示调试菜单
menu.show();
应用案例和最佳实践
应用案例
- 游戏开发:在游戏开发中,开发者可以使用
debug-menu
快速调整游戏参数,如角色属性、游戏速度等,以便于测试和调试。 - 前端应用:在前端应用中,可以使用
debug-menu
快速切换不同的主题、语言或调试模式,提高开发效率。
最佳实践
- 模块化设计:将调试菜单的配置和逻辑分离,便于管理和维护。
- 权限控制:确保调试菜单只在开发环境或特定权限下可见,避免在生产环境中暴露敏感功能。
典型生态项目
debug-menu
可以与以下项目结合使用,以增强调试功能:
- React DevTools:用于调试 React 应用的浏览器扩展,可以与
debug-menu
结合使用,提供更全面的调试体验。 - Redux DevTools:用于调试 Redux 状态管理的工具,可以与
debug-menu
结合,方便地查看和修改应用状态。
通过这些生态项目的结合,可以大大提升开发和调试的效率。